Fig. 1: Raindrop- and mechanical stimuli (MS)-induced transcriptome profiles highly correlate with each other.

a Enriched Gene Ontology (GO) categories of 1050 raindrop (10 falling droplets)-induced genes in the wild type (Col-0) 15 min after treatment. The top 10 categories are shown in ascending order of P values (one-sided hypergeometric test). b, c Transcript levels of MS-induced and defense-related genes in 4-week-old Col-0 plants 15 min after being treated with 10 falling droplets (raindrop, b) or 1 brushing (MS, c), determined by RT-qPCR and normalized to UBIQUITIN 5 (UBQ5). Data are presented as mean ± SD. n = 6 plants examined over three independent experiments. Each dot indicates a technical replicate. d Enriched GO categories of 1241 MS (1 brushing)-induced genes in Col-0 15 min after treatment. The top ten categories are shown in ascending order of P values (one-sided hypergeometric test). e Venn diagram of the overlap between transcriptome datasets from raindrop- and MS-induced genes (likelihood ratio test; P < 0.05). f Radar chart of intensity compared with mock (log2FC) and Pearson correlation coefficient (r = 0.917288423) of 917 raindrop- and MS-induced genes (left). Intensities of major immune regulator genes induced by raindrops and MS in RNA-seq analysis (log2FC) (likelihood ratio test; P < 0.05) (right).
